How to make a crop top bigger? Help!

Hey, this sounds like a silly topic but I've bought a top online, its too small but I've missed the returns date so ive decided ill try and make it fit haha. Its a plunge crop top and its really pretty but it doesn't fit around my bust, its too small. It fits around my ribs if that makes sense, but the triangle bit is too small. So I was wondering if there are any fashion helpers that could guide me into making this fit? I'm up for sewing and everything so any help would be amazing because I don't know where to start!

Heres a little description of the top: Thin straps, plunge front with a slight cross over and then a band around underneath the bust(the bit that fits).

You could try adding some binding around the cups, but this can look messy unless your top is a dark colour. A nice idea might be to add some lace as you can get quite thick lace trimming if need be and just hand sew it to the inside of the cups. You'd need some reasonably thick lace, nothing too flimsy or it will just curl up.
